WebFeb 17, 2024 · Oral: 20 minutes to 2 hours (McNeil 1984); IV: Within 5 minutes (Goa 1989); Peak effect: Oral: 2 to 4 hours; IV: 5 to 15 minutes (Goa 1989) Time to Peak Plasma: Oral: …

Intravenous route of administration of labetalol: This is the fastest way to administer labetalol and is used to treat emergencies with high blood pressure or to quickly control severe hypertension.
